Class of 2022 – Honoring the Journey

Written by

On Wednesday, Nov. 10, parents and caregivers of the Friends Academy Class of 2022 joined us at Mill River Club for a luncheon to celebrate the journeys of their students and families. Andrea Kelly, Head of School, thanked them for their support with events such as Fall Fair, with fundraisers, field trips, bake sales, and athletics. In the months leading up to graduation, she encouraged them to stay in the moment. “Thank you for your years of commitment to Friends Academy, for sharing your children with us, and for carrying the Friends Academy banner proudly beyond our walls and beyond your time here,” Andrea said. “We are and always will be profoundly grateful.” 

Rosie Mangiarotti '14, the keynote speaker, shared her own college experience and how she found her passion for entrepreneurship. She attended Brown University and recently founded Perkies, a company specializing in undergarments for women.
